The latest mileage data for the Volvo S40 (2004-07) indicates that most recorded readings cluster around the 80,000 to 100,000 mile range, accounting for approximately 23.1% of vehicles. Notably, a significant proportion of vehicles have mileage between 70,000 and 80,000 miles (12%) and 90,000 to 100,000 miles (12.8%), suggesting these are common mileage brackets for this model. Very low mileage vehicles (0 to 10,000 miles) are rare, comprising less than 1%, while higher mileage vehicles approaching or exceeding 200,000 miles are also quite uncommon, collectively representing less than 4%. Overall, the data reveals a prevalence of vehicles with mid-range mileage, highlighting typical usage patterns for this model age.

The data indicates that for the Volvo S40 (2004-07) 1.8 125 S model, the majority of private sale prices fall within the £0 to £1,000 range, accounting for 65% of listings. A smaller portion, 35%, are listed between £1,000 and £2,000. This suggests that most private sales are at the lower end of the price spectrum, which may reflect the vehicle's age, mileage, or condition. Overall, potential buyers can expect to find the majority of these vehicles at budget-friendly prices within the under-£1,000 category.

The data indicates that, among Volvo S40 models manufactured between 2004 and 2007, the highest proportion (37.6%) were produced in 2005. The second most common year is 2006 with 29.9%, followed by 2007 at 17.1%, and the earliest, 2004, accounting for 15.4%. This suggests that the 2005 model year is the most prevalent in the sample, possibly reflecting higher production volumes or longer remaining service life for vehicles from that year.

The data indicates that the most common paint colours for the Volvo S40 (2004-07) 4DR Saloon 1.8 125 S are Silver (21.4%), Grey (20.5%), and Blue (19.7%), suggesting a preference for neutral and classic hues among these vehicles. Interestingly, Black and Green are also quite prevalent, each comprising around 15% and 10% respectively, while brighter colours like Red and Purple are less common, representing approximately 9.4% and 2.6%. Notably, White is quite rare, making up less than 1%, which might reflect trends or market preferences for this model during its production years.
